Hackney Wick train station is equipped with essential facilities to ensure a comfortable experience, although it might lack some of the niceties you'd find in larger stations. For buying tickets, you can make use of the ticket machines and collect pre-purchased tickets from there as well. However, traditional ticket office services are limited to weekday mornings (from 07:30 to 10:00). The station's notable focus on accessibility includes step-free access throughout, accessible ticket machines, and a range of facilities tailored to assist those needing additional support.
The station is aimed at being inclusive for all travelers. While there are no ordinary toilets, you will find accessible toilets available, making it easier for everyone to navigate through journeys without unnecessary hassle. Additionally, waiting rooms are open Monday to Friday from 07:00 to 13:00, but note there isn't continuous staff assistance throughout the week.
Getting around from Hackney Wick is straightforward thanks to its decent local transport connections. For those times when rail services are interrupted, bus stops in Hepscott Road offer rail replacement services, ensuring you can still make your way east towards Stratford or west towards Camden Road, Hampstead Heath, and Richmond. It should be noted that while cycling is encouraged, with storage for up to six bicycles monitored by CCTV, there are no cycle hire facilities at the station.

Hooton Station has an array of amenities to accommodate your travel needs. The ticket office operates extended hours from 05:24 to 00:27 Monday through Saturday and 07:29 to 00:27 on Sundays, making it convenient for early birds and night owls. Although there aren't ticket machines, collecting pre-purchased tickets at the office streamline the process. Accessibility is a priority with step-free access available across the station, complemented by ramps for train access and tactile paving.
The station offers adequate seating areas and waiting rooms, though there’s no first-class lounge. Need to grab a quick refreshment? Vending machines serve cold drinks, but there aren’t any shops or ATMs onsite. Cyclists benefit from secure storage options for their bikes with a capacity of 54 spaces, with options to reserve online via Merseyrail's website.
Hooton Station is well-connected with various onward travel options, though there's no taxi rank on premises. For those venturing further afield, efficient bus services link the station with surrounding areas. More detailed travel itineraries can be planned through Merseytravel’s website or by contacting their Traveline. If you’re heading to the skies, Liverpool John Lennon Airport is just a seamless rail and bus journey away, with interconnected ticketing available for ease of travel.
